Santaquin vs South Ogden
Side-by-side comparison
How does Santaquin, UT compare to South Ogden, UT? Santaquin has a population of 15,391 with a median household income of $95,175, while South Ogden has 17,563 residents and a median income of $81,543. Below you'll find a detailed breakdown of demographics, economy, and housing for both cities.
| Metric | Santaquin, UT | South Ogden, UT |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Population | 15,391 | 17,563 | -12.4% |
| Median Age | 27.1 | 33.1 | -18.1% |
| Foreign Born % | 3.6% | 5.3% | -32.1% |
| Metric | Santaquin | South Ogden |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Median Income | $95,175 | $81,543 | +16.7% |
| Unemployment | 2.5% | 2.3% | +8.7% |
| Poverty Rate | 3.7% | 7.8% | -52.6% |
| Bachelor's+ | 25.8% | 33.2% | -22.3% |
| Metric | Santaquin | South Ogden |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Home Value | $434,700 | $371,100 | +17.1% |
| Median Rent | $1165/mo | $1334/mo | -12.7% |
| Housing Units | 4,273 | 6,946 | -38.5% |
